探索游戏三国志街机项目:在GitHub上的全景

介绍

《三国志街机》是一款受欢迎的街机游戏,以其丰富的剧情和独特的游戏机制而著称。随着开源文化的普及,越来越多的开发者和玩家开始关注该游戏的源代码,并希望能够在GitHub上找到相关资源。

GitHub上的三国志街机项目

GitHub是一个代码托管平台,上面有很多关于《三国志街机》的项目。以下是一些相关项目的介绍:

  • 三国志街机开源项目:此项目提供了完整的源代码,可以让开发者进行二次开发。
  • 游戏资源库:此库包含了游戏中的音效、图像和动画,便于制作MOD。
  • 社区支持:GitHub上有很多用户提供了使用指南和开发文档,帮助新手入门。

三国志街机的特点

1. 丰富的游戏剧情

游戏以三国演义为背景,玩家可以选择不同的角色进行战斗,每个角色都有独特的技能和故事线。

2. 独特的游戏机制

  • 实时战斗系统:玩家需要快速反应,进行实时战斗。
  • 角色成长系统:通过战斗获得经验,提升角色的能力。

如何在GitHub上找到三国志街机项目

  • 使用搜索功能:在GitHub主页输入“游戏三国志街机”即可找到相关项目。
  • 关注项目更新:可以关注感兴趣的项目,以获取最新动态和更新。

三国志街机的代码结构

1. 文件目录结构

|- src | |- characters | |- levels | |- assets | |- main.cpp |- docs |- README.md

  • src:源代码文件夹,包含游戏的核心逻辑。
  • docs:文档文件夹,包含项目的说明和开发指南。
  • README.md:项目的概述和使用指南。

2. 主要模块

  • 角色模块:定义了所有角色的属性和技能。
  • 关卡模块:包含各个关卡的设计和逻辑。
  • 资产模块:管理游戏中的所有图像和音效文件。

如何使用三国志街机项目

1. 克隆项目

在终端中输入以下命令: bash git clone https://github.com/yourusername/sgzhj.git

2. 安装依赖

根据项目文档,使用合适的包管理工具安装所需的依赖。通常是: bash npm install

3. 启动游戏

执行以下命令以启动游戏: bash npm start

常见问题解答 (FAQ)

Q1: 如何贡献代码?

A1: 你可以通过提交PR(Pull Request)来贡献代码。在开始之前,请务必阅读项目的贡献指南。

Q2: 是否支持多人游戏?

A2: 当前版本只支持单人游戏,但社区中有开发者正在开发多人模式的MOD。

Q3: 可以在手机上玩吗?

A3: 目前项目只支持PC端,开发者正在考虑移植到移动平台。

Q4: 如何报告错误?

A4: 可以在GitHub项目页面的“Issues”标签中提交你的问题和建议。

总结

《三国志街机》作为一款经典的街机游戏,通过GitHub开源项目,为广大开发者和玩家提供了一个宝贵的资源平台。无论是想要深入了解游戏机制,还是希望参与到项目开发中来,这里都能找到你所需要的内容。让我们一起为这个经典游戏增添更多的乐趣与价值吧!

正文完